Classical architecture wikipedia. Classical architecture usually denotes architecture which is more or less consciously derived from the principles of greek and roman architecture of classical antiquity, or sometimes even more specifically, from the works of vitruvius. Different styles of classical architecture have arguably existed since the carolingian renaissance, and prominently since the italian renaissance. Although classical styles of architecture can vary greatly, they can in general all be said to draw on a common "voca. Classical architecture britannica. Classical architecture, architecture of ancient greece and rome, especially from the 5th century bce in greece to the 3rd century ce in rome, that emphasized the column and pediment. Greek architecture was based chiefly on the postandbeam system, with columns carrying the load. Timber construction was superseded by construction in marble and stone. Baroque architecture essential humanities. Baroque architecture is distinguished primarily by richly sculpted surfaces.Whereas renaissance architects preferred planar classicism (flat surfaces veneered in classical elements), baroque architects freely moulded surfaces to achieve threedimensional sculpted classicism (see example). Roman architecture ancient history encyclopedia. · the architectural orders. Roman architects continued to follow the guidelines established by the classical orders the greeks had first shaped doric, ionic, and corinthian. The corinthian was particularly favoured and many roman buildings, even into late antiquity, would have a particularly greek look to them. Greek architectural orders smarthistory. The doric order is the earliest of the three classical orders of architecture and represents an important moment in mediterranean architecture when monumental construction made the transition from impermanent materials (i.E. Wood) to permanent materials, namely stone.
